Adverse Event Clinical Research R4 Backport
1.0.0-ballot - ballot International flag

This page is part of the Adverse Event Clinical Research R4 Backport (v1.0.0-ballot: STU 1 Ballot 1) based on FHIR R4. . For a full list of available versions, see the Directory of published versions

Extension: Mitigating Action

Official URL: http://hl7.org/fhir/uv/ae-research-backport-ig/StructureDefinition/mitigating-action Version: 1.0.0-ballot
Standards status: Trial-use Maturity Level: 2 Computable Name: MitigatingAction

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.

Context of Use

This extension may be used on the following element(s):

  • Element ID AdverseEvent

Usage info

Usage:

Formal Views of Extension Content

Description of Profiles, Differentials, Snapshots, and how the XML and JSON presentations work.

This structure is derived from Extension

Summary

Complex Extension: 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.

  • item: CodeableConcept, Reference: An Extension

Maturity: 2

This structure is derived from Extension

NameFlagsCard.TypeDescription & Constraintsdoco
.. Extension 0..*ExtensionMitigating Action
... extension 1..*ExtensionExtension
... extension:item 1..1ExtensionAmeliorating action taken after the adverse event occurred in order to reduce the extent of harm
.... extension 0..0
.... url 1..1uri"item"
.... Slices for value[x] 0..1CodeableConcept, Reference()Value of extension
Slice: Unordered, Open by type:$this
..... value[x]:valueReference 0..1Reference(Procedure | DocumentReference | MedicationAdministration | MedicationRequest)Value of extension
..... value[x]:valueCodeableConcept 0..1CodeableConceptValue of extension
Binding: AdverseEvent Mitigating Action (example): Codes describing the 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.

... url 1..1uri"http://hl7.org/fhir/uv/ae-research-backport-ig/StructureDefinition/mitigating-action"

doco Documentation for this format
NameFlagsCard.TypeDescription & Constraintsdoco
.. Extension 0..*ExtensionMitigating Action
... id 0..1stringUnique id for inter-element referencing
... Slices for extension 1..*ExtensionExtension
Slice: Unordered, Open by value:url
... extension:item 1..1ExtensionAmeliorating action taken after the adverse event occurred in order to reduce the extent of harm
.... id 0..1stringUnique id for inter-element referencing
.... extension 0..0
.... url 1..1uri"item"
.... Slices for value[x] 0..1Value of extension
Slice: Unordered, Closed by type:$this
..... valueCodeableConceptCodeableConcept
..... valueReferenceReference(Any)
..... value[x]:valueReference 0..1Reference(Procedure | DocumentReference | MedicationAdministration | MedicationRequest)Value of extension
..... value[x]:valueCodeableConcept 0..1CodeableConceptValue of extension
Binding: AdverseEvent Mitigating Action (example): Codes describing the 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.


doco Documentation for this format

This structure is derived from Extension

Summary

Complex Extension: 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.

  • item: CodeableConcept, Reference: An Extension

Maturity: 2

Differential View

This structure is derived from Extension

NameFlagsCard.TypeDescription & Constraintsdoco
.. Extension 0..*ExtensionMitigating Action
... extension 1..*ExtensionExtension
... extension:item 1..1ExtensionAmeliorating action taken after the adverse event occurred in order to reduce the extent of harm
.... extension 0..0
.... url 1..1uri"item"
.... Slices for value[x] 0..1CodeableConcept, Reference()Value of extension
Slice: Unordered, Open by type:$this
..... value[x]:valueReference 0..1Reference(Procedure | DocumentReference | MedicationAdministration | MedicationRequest)Value of extension
..... value[x]:valueCodeableConcept 0..1CodeableConceptValue of extension
Binding: AdverseEvent Mitigating Action (example): Codes describing the 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.

... url 1..1uri"http://hl7.org/fhir/uv/ae-research-backport-ig/StructureDefinition/mitigating-action"

doco Documentation for this format

Snapshot View

NameFlagsCard.TypeDescription & Constraintsdoco
.. Extension 0..*ExtensionMitigating Action
... id 0..1stringUnique id for inter-element referencing
... Slices for extension 1..*ExtensionExtension
Slice: Unordered, Open by value:url
... extension:item 1..1ExtensionAmeliorating action taken after the adverse event occurred in order to reduce the extent of harm
.... id 0..1stringUnique id for inter-element referencing
.... extension 0..0
.... url 1..1uri"item"
.... Slices for value[x] 0..1Value of extension
Slice: Unordered, Closed by type:$this
..... valueCodeableConceptCodeableConcept
..... valueReferenceReference(Any)
..... value[x]:valueReference 0..1Reference(Procedure | DocumentReference | MedicationAdministration | MedicationRequest)Value of extension
..... value[x]:valueCodeableConcept 0..1CodeableConceptValue of extension
Binding: AdverseEvent Mitigating Action (example): Codes describing the ameliorating actions taken after the adverse event occurred in order to reduce the extent of harm.


doco Documentation for this format

 

Other representations of profile: CSV, Excel, Schematron

Terminology Bindings

PathConformanceValueSet
Extension.extension:item.value[x]:valueCodeableConceptexampleAdverseEventMitigatingAction

Constraints

IdGradePath(s)DetailsRequirements
ele-1error**ALL** elementsAll FHIR elements must have a @value or children
: hasValue() or (children().count() > id.count())
ext-1error**ALL** extensionsMust have either extensions or value[x], not both
: extension.exists() != value.exists()